On Monday night, UK Prime Minister Rishi Sunak spoke by phone with President Paul Kagame about the disputed plan to send refugees to Rwanda.

The leaders are “committed to continue working together to ensure that this vital partnership is delivered successfully,” according to a Downing Street statement.
Despite resistance, the UK government’s plan to send some asylum seekers to Rwanda was upheld by the British High Court in December 2022.
The plan’s detractors had claimed that it violates human rights laws and that Rwanda is not a safe location for asylum seekers.
The British government will present plans for a new legislation banning individuals from entering the country through unofficial channels on Tuesday.
